1

Choose Cleveland Roofing Specialists for Fast, Efficient, and Affordable Roofing Services

News Discuss 
A Comprehensive Overview to Effective Roof Covering Apartment Roofing Setup The intricacies of level roof installment need a precise approach, starting with a detailed understanding of various level roof covering kinds and the vital products needed for optimal performance. A successful setup hinges not only on the option of materials https://residential-roofing-perth60236.ourcodeblog.com/33288155/professional-flat-roof-installation-in-cuyahoga-falls-for-durable-and-reliable-results

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story